Output e8703013828a0f907fda59bf2d537ef87ec0310f4c151d85069127f787084ff0:0

value
52649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6291cad9efef4442844db574927c2ef5766a94ac OP_EQUAL
address
3AgCoB9moBttM11i6LuL11jzRauPpWbywk
transaction
e8703013828a0f907fda59bf2d537ef87ec0310f4c151d85069127f787084ff0
confirmations
231405
spent
true